The rules behind the numbers

How the law does the maths

Art. 5 of the Euro Introduction Act

Fixed rate, no exceptions

1 EUR = 1.95583 BGN — the rate at which every lev value is recalculated: capital, shares, nominal share values. There is no "eyeballed" rounding: the conversion is done to the cent, and only then is the correction rule applied.

Art. 32(5) of the Euro Introduction Act

Correction up to ±5%

So the capital does not stay at "€2,556.46", the law allows an increase or decrease of up to 5% — enough for a round figure. The correction cannot take the capital below the statutory minimum and cannot change the ratios between the partners.

Art. 32(1) of the Euro Introduction Act

Deadline and zero fee

The converted documents are filed for announcement by 31 December 2026 — on their own or with the next application. No state fee is due (Art. 32(4)). After the deadline: sanctions under Art. 59(5)(7) of the Euro Introduction Act and an automatic non-rounded figure.
